You can't beat the convenience or the charm

Everyone's entitled to an opinion. My friend has lived at Dixon Mills for nine years(!)and absolutely loves the place. He lives in a large studio on the third floor of Building 'B', the largest building that faces onto Columbus Drive. Never any problems with maintenance issues, as mentioned by others--I suppose one should steer clear of any units beneath the skylights.
We became so enamored that we bought one of the newer larger units. You can't beat the historic architectural detail, high ceilings. It's so convenient to both the PATH as well as to the Turnpike. So it's good for NY or NJ commuters. We thought it was a good buy, considering the prices we'd have to pay in New York--and it's just as close, or closer, to downtown NY than the other boroughs. Love the diversity of the area and the profusion of restaurants. Also it's not as sterile or corporate as the fancy skyscraper towers that are popping up all around the Grove Street Path. After 9 years, we see the area moving up, dramatically, and we've bought a unit and we're stayin'.
